UH Manoa / UHM Graduate Tuition and Fees

$23,620 Average Tuition and Fees (In-State)

Information about average full-time graduate tuition and fees is shown in the table below.

In State Out of State
Tuition $22,848 $46,272
Fees $772 $772

Master’s Student Diversity

In the most recent graduating class, 67% of finance & financial management master’s degrees went to men and 33% went to women.

UH Manoa / UHM gender breakdown of Finance & Financial Management Master's degree grads The largest share of finance & financial management master’s degree graduates at UH Manoa / UHM are Asian. About 47% of graduates fell into this category.

The following table and chart show the ethnic background for students who recently graduated from University of Hawaii at Manoa with a master’s in finance & financial management.

Ethnic diversity of Finance & Financial Management majors at University of Hawaii at Manoa
Ethnic Background Number of Students
Asian 7
Black or African American 0
Hispanic or Latino 1
White 2
Non-Resident Aliens 1
Other Races 4
